When YOU add an image to your Spout, you see the ALT TEXT overlay... RIGHT?

That's for people using Screen Readers.

Those friends either can't see or need help processing YOUR image. Without #AltText your spout is MEANINGLESS to them.

Some, not just visually impaired, can't see or even process images, so they use a Screen Reader.

When the Screen Reader gets to an image with no Alt Text... there's nothing to read! It might just say "image."
